An Executive Certificate in Cross-cultural Healthcare Regulation equ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to navigate the complexities of global healthcare systems. This intensive program focuses on legal frameworks, ethical considerations, and cultural nuances impacting healthcare delivery across borders.
Learning outcomes include a deep understanding of international healthcare regulations, effective cross-cultural communication strategies within healthcare settings, and the ability to analyze and resolve ethical dilemmas arising from cultural differences in patient care. Graduates gain proficiency in navigating diverse regulatory environments, a crucial skill in today's interconnected world.
The duration of the Executive Certificate in Cross-cultural Healthcare Regulation typically ranges from several months to a year, depending on the program's intensity and structure. Many programs offer flexible online learning options, catering to busy professionals.
